Mark your calendar now! Friday, Saturday, and Sunday - June 1, 2, and 3, 2018 at Camp West Mar.

Big change to Camp West Mar is all-new furniture in the bunkhouses. For the first time, we will let pre-registrants reserve their bunk for either one or two nights.

phil.ager wrote:What’s the situation regarding cell-reception and internet access?

I checked it today. T-Mobile has no reception but Verizon has a decent signal.

Wi-Fi is available from Camp West-Mar but it is paid access. $2.95 buys 12 hours worth of connection.
